删除数据库的命令是什么?

删除数据库的命令是什么?,第1张

概述删除数据库命令是什么?

删除数据库的命令是“DELETE DATA”,具体格式为“DROP DATABASE [IF EXISTS] 数据库名;”,可以删除数据库中的所有表格并同时删除数据库。如果要使用“DROP DATABASE”,需要获得数据库DROP权限。

当数据库不再使用时应该将其删除,以确保数据库存储空间中存放的是有效数据。删除数据库是将已经存在的数据库从磁盘空间上清除,清除之后,数据库中的所有数据也将一同被删除。

(推荐教程:mysql视频教程)

在 MysqL 中,当需要删除已创建的数据库时,可以使用 DROP DATABASE 语句。其语法格式为:

DROP DATABASE [ IF EXISTS ] 数据库名

语法说明如下:

数据库名:指定要删除的数据库名。

IF EXISTS:用于防止当数据库不存在时发生错误。

DROP DATABASE:删除数据库中的所有表格并同时删除数据库。使用此语句时要非常小心,以免错误删除。如果要使用 DROP DATABASE,需要获得数据库 DROP 权限。

注意:MysqL 安装后,系统会自动创建名为 information_schema 和 MysqL 的两个系统数据库,系统数据库存放一些和数据库相关的信息,如果删除了这两个数据库,MysqL 将不能正常工作。

示例:

查看数据库

MysqL> SHOW DATABASES;+--------------------+| Database           |+--------------------+| information_schema || MysqL              || performance_schema || sakila             || sys                || test_db            || test_db_char       || test_db_del        || world              |+--------------------+9 rows in set (0.00 sec)

使用命令行工具将数据库 test_db_del 从数据库列表中删除

MysqL> DROP DATABASE test_db_del;query OK, 0 rows affected (0.57 sec)MysqL> SHOW DATABASES;+--------------------+| Database           |+--------------------+| information_schema || MysqL              || performance_schema || sakila             || sys                || test_db            || test_db_char       || world              |+--------------------+8 rows in set (0.00 sec)

此时数据库 test_db_del 不存在。

更多编程相关知识,请访问:编程教学!! 总结

以上是内存溢出为你收集整理的删除数据库的命令是什么?全部内容,希望文章能够帮你解决删除数据库的命令是什么?所遇到的程序开发问题。

如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/sjk/1150553.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2022-05-31
下一篇2022-05-31

发表评论

登录后才能评论

评论列表(0条)

    保存